So I am working through Deluxe Revised Recon (and I am digging it- A Palladium Product to boot!) but I came across something that is confusing me:

In character creation how to figure out the skills confunses me:

There is a Random Method or MOS, I understand whichever you choose gives you the number of skills you have in certain areas.

Where I am confused is the note after the charts: All 'nam style characters recieve their numbers of skills after their Primary MOS.

So odes this mean we get the skills listed with our primary MOS automatically and then skills listed on the chart?

Well you can do it a number of ways.

1) Character gets all the MOS skills, plus the aditional skills.
2) Character has to buy MOS skills with their alotted skill numbers.

Whatever way you do it, just do it the same way all the time.
